ASUS Super Alloy Components on Direct CU 6870 GPU

Post by Apoptosis »

Asus has just unveiled to the world its second Radeon HD 6870 card, a model equipped with a dual-slot DirectCU cooler and boasting Super Alloy Chokes, Super Alloy Capacitors, Super Alloy MOS which ensure a longer product life, higher stability and a cooler (up to 35 degrees Celsius) operation.

The new card has 1120 Stream Processors, a GPU clock of 915 MHz, a 256-bit memory interface, 1GB of GDDR5 VRAM @ 4200 MHz, dual-DVI, HDMI and DisplayPort outputs, it includes the Super Hybrid Engine technology that automatically adjusts clocks/consumption depending on needs, and the Voltage Tweak function which enables easy overclocking.
